Output f9265a1c43f30fd3b83e1c7e1f92c38e765284d073ef16f17d8e42b5dca3f005:5

value
13586106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98f218b6d3c5a3ae4f55d28302bb6a61b62c130a OP_EQUALVERIFY OP_CHECKSIG
address
1EwhjKbq7xrrCYWWyUTV2MHVf4ZkZ6yXV6
transaction
f9265a1c43f30fd3b83e1c7e1f92c38e765284d073ef16f17d8e42b5dca3f005
spent
true